The STEMM program goes far beyond helping young mothers with education and extends to child abuse, sexual abuse, homelessness and domestic violence. Several of the girls currently in the program at Burnside are from Caloundra and they all need our help. The education is government funded and Queensland Health helps out a lot with the Child Health Nurse and Midwife but they fall short in their counselling, food, transport, and assisting the participants at home.
